尝试上传一个带有mvc4的文件,但我的控制器在上传文件时返回null。有没有人能明白为什么?
查看模型
public class PostExtendedWithImage
{
public Post post { get; set; }
public HttpPostedFileBase file { get; set; }
}
视图
@using (Ajax.BeginForm("CreatePost", "Wall", new AjaxOptions
{
HttpMethod = "post",
Inser
我对AJAX几乎没有(几乎没有)经验。
我想要创建一个示例表单,在这里我可以上传图像文件(想想eBay拍卖),但是这些文件可以(而且应该)被拖放到浏览器窗口中,就像当您将APK上传到Google时一样。
我从来没有做过这样的事,我想学习。我目前还没有一个真正的用例来实现,我要求学习。那么,让我们选择eBay示例。
我的ViewModel可能如下所示:
public class AuctionViewModel {
public string Title, Description;
public double Price;
[...]
public IEnume